chances are, you’ve experienced stress in your life.  (i know i have!)  whether it’s work-related, home-related, or otherwise, stress plagues everybody from time to time.  and a little stress here and there is no biggie, but if your stress is persistent, keeps you from being productive, and seeps into your downtime, it’s time for a change.

for me, rushing and stress go hand in hand.  when i’m stressed, i rush.  and when i rush, i’m stressed.  and thus, the stress-cycle is perpetuated.  but i recently read something in yoga journal that got me thinking — “am i rushing because i’m under stress, or am i under stress because i’m rushing?”  hmmmm…..

stress, oftentimes, feels like it’s out of our control — it’s “put upon us” by our bosses, our spouses, our families — but, the rushing (or the sense of needing to rush), i can get a handle on.

if in those moments when i can feel stress compounding and the urgency to rush sets in, if i instead, stop, take a deep breath (or two), and slow down, the stress and rushing subsides.  instead of tackling the stress (mental), tackle the rushing (physical) — and you will notice that your mind and mental state respond to your bodies actions.  if you act calm, you’ll become calm — simple as that!

the next time you’re feeling stressed and rushing around — SLOW DOWN and breathe.  and just notice if you feel better — i bet you will!
